The Impact of RMB Exchange Rate Adjustment on China's Macro Economy in the Post-epidemic Era

Since the outbreak of the new crown epidemic in early 2020, due to different countries' control of the epidemic, global economic uncertainty has increased. As a barometer of economic activities such as manufacturing and trade, the renminbi exchange rate has shown a Two-way fluctuation trend of first devaluation and then appreciation. Especially after June, the renminbi exchange rate against the U.S. dollar has strengthened along with the rebound of the U.S. epidemic, and the central parity rate is close to June 2019 New highs after. During this period, the yield of my country's national debt first fell and then rose, showing a strong correlation with the exchange rate in the graphical trend. Based on the Two-way fluctuations in the RMB exchange rate, the author analyzes how the exchange rate affects interest rates, and tries to predict the central bank's response policies.
